    110 long action 243 to 6mm-06ai


    I have for quite some time wanted to build a 6mm-06ai. There is a 110 243 at one of my local gun shops. It has the 5.062 screw placing. I've read that the magazine port would have to be lengthened for an 06 length cartridge. What i'm wondering is how costly that would be and who could i get to do it. I also would like to know if the chamber can be lengthened to 6mm-06ai by hand or would it have to be done on a lathe? As I would like to do as much of the work myself as possible (for the experience) Thanks in advance for any input.

    As far as I know you would need the action milled out to hold the longer mag box and follower. If you were to only use as a single shot you wouldnt need to have anything done to it.

    As far as reaming out the chamber manually..... Ive seen the tools, but have never used them. A lathe would definitely hold much tighter tolerances than doing it by hand. I would much rather have a good smith do it on a lathe.

    Actually, I would have a smith do a new barrel if it were me, I think youll be better off in the long run. You could part out the rifle and keep the action and help pay for the new barrel.
    I think the choice of cartridge is a screamer....AI version should top the 240wby.

    If it were me Id buy the 270 or 06 and change the barrel. If you get the tools....the barrel swap is easy. The advantage of the long action(the long action built for 06, 270 etc....actual LA cartridges) is you can build either a short or long action cartridge on it.
